Subject: Quickstore 4.2 — bloom filter now fronts the KV layer

Plugin authors: starting with this release, Quickstore places a bloom filter ahead of the key-value store. Negative lookups return faster; false positives fall through safely. No API changes are required on your side. Verify your plugin against the staging build referenced below.

session token of fahif-tadup = htk3_9c7

- [ ] Step 7: Archive cold storage buckets (Glacierline tier). Confirm both ceremony witnesses are present, verify bucket manifests match the Oxbow ledger, then seal the archive key shares. Plugin authors may observe but not handle shares. Once sealed, the archive index itself is encrypted and can only be reopened with the passphrase below.

vault phrase of badup-hahig = tamael-aldael-kelmir-istael-fenok-istwyn-tamius-jorath-oliion

Effective this sprint, ownership of the log compaction subsystem in Corvid MQ is transferring. This covers the compaction scheduler, tombstone retention settings, and the segment-merge path that caused the disk-bloat incident last quarter. Open items at handoff: the off-by-one in retention window calculation (patch in review) and the proposal to make compaction interval per-topic. Design docs and the incident retrospective are linked in the team wiki. Direct all future compaction questions and reviews to the new owner, named below.

approver of yajef-fajef = Oliwyn Silion Kasok Kasox